Adjustable TPU Glasses Strap

Stop letting your glasses slide down your nose. This adjustable TPU strap is engineered to provide a secure, tight hold with zero fuss. 👓

After reviewing numerous alternatives, this model was built from the ground up to eliminate excessive post-processing and weak friction fits. It is designed entirely around the flexibility and grip of TPU, ensuring your eyewear stays exactly where it belongs.

 

🛠️ Design Advantages:

  • Ultra-Lightweight Efficiency: Optimized to use minimal filament. The standard version requires only 2.9g, and the extended version takes just 3.8g. You can see the plate layout in the photos provided.
  • Seamless Assembly: No tools or post-print gluing necessary. Simply slide the cables through the slits in the sliders at the end and insert your glasses' arms directly into the end sockets. 
  • Secure Tolerances: Engineered specifically to ensure a tight, reliable grip that will not slip during active use. The assembled fit is demonstrated in photos provided.
  • Customizable Hold: While designed for a friction fit, you can opt to glue the sliders shut for an aggressively tight, permanent adjustment. Make sure you do not glue the straps onto the slider though!

📏 Available Versions:

  • Standard: 175mm total strap length with a 145mm adjustable band.
  • Extended: 260mm total strap length with a 230mm adjustable band.
